    A search and rescue mission continues for a 36-year-old man missing in Rotorua since September 30


    Jayleb-Che was last known to be near Waiotapu Loop Road, and police are asking public in the area to search their properties.

    Police are interested in seeing any dashcam or CCTV footage, and are keen to speak to anyone who used the local hot and cold pools around the date he went missing.
